1. FC Nürnberg has confirmed LEBARA Mobile Germany Limited as a new addition to its commercial partner network. The agreement coincides with the club’s 125th anniversary celebrations and includes a custom fan offer, integrating LEBARA’s mobile services into the club’s growing ecosystem of member-focused benefits.


The partnership positions LEBARA as a digital services partner, supporting 1. FCN’s ongoing strategy to broaden its sponsorship portfolio through category-relevant, value-driven collaborations.


Telecom Brand Targets Regional Engagement


LEBARA Mobile, founded in the UK in 2001, operates across five European markets and is headquartered in Düsseldorf for its German operations. Known for flexible and affordable tariffs, LEBARA has positioned itself as a telecommunications provider focused on connectivity, accessibility, and sustainability — with features such as CO₂-neutral SIM card production and FSC-certified packaging already part of its business model.


For 1. FC Nürnberg, the partnership is expected to enhance fan services and brand activation opportunities, particularly through LEBARA’s inclusion in the club’s “Rot-Schwarze Vorteilswelt” — a member-exclusive benefits platform. 1. FC Nürnberg LEBARA


As part of the launch, LEBARA has introduced a “Jubiläumstarif” (anniversary tariff) tailored to FCN fans, underlining the club’s intent to celebrate its heritage with added value for supporters.


Strategic Alignment with Shared Values 1. FC Nürnberg LEBARA


Both parties have emphasized community engagement and inclusivity as shared values behind the collaboration. The partnership will include digital visibility across the club’s media channels and extend to broader commercial initiatives.


“1. FC Nürnberg represents community, social responsibility, and meaningful experiences — values that align with what LEBARA stands for,” said Katja Schumacher, Managing Director at LEBARA Germany.

“The club lives and breathes connection — on and off the pitch — making this a natural partnership,” added Dirk Schlünz, CEO of 1. FCN Marketing GmbH.

By integrating LEBARA into its sponsorship structure, Nürnberg continues to modernize its commercial ecosystem and appeal to younger, digitally native audiences, including multicultural demographics that often engage with flexible telecom brands like LEBARA.
